About Licensing Law in Little India, Singapore

Licensing law in Little India, Singapore governs the regulation and control of various activities and businesses in the area. This includes licenses for operating businesses, selling alcohol, organizing events, and more. Understanding and complying with licensing laws is essential to avoid legal issues and penalties.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. What types of licenses are required for businesses in Little India, Singapore?

Businesses in Little India, Singapore may require licenses for activities such as selling alcohol, operating a food establishment, organizing events, and providing certain services. The specific type of license depends on the nature of the business and its activities.

2. How can I apply for a license in Little India, Singapore?

To apply for a license in Little India, Singapore, you will need to submit an application to the relevant government agency, provide the necessary documentation, and comply with all requirements outlined in the licensing regulations. It is advisable to seek legal assistance to ensure a smooth application process.

3. What are the penalties for operating without a license in Little India, Singapore?

Operating without a license in Little India, Singapore can result in fines, license suspension or revocation, and even criminal charges in some cases. It is crucial to obtain the necessary licenses before commencing any business activities to avoid legal consequences.

8. Are there specific regulations for alcohol licenses in Little India, Singapore?

Yes, there are specific regulations for alcohol licenses in Little India, Singapore, including restrictions on the sale of alcohol to minors, operating hours for establishments serving alcohol, and compliance with public safety standards. It is essential to comply with these regulations to maintain a valid alcohol license.
